Description
Photograph of Peach Spring Trail, Grand Canyon, Arizona, 1900-1930. A Yuccatilla plant grows in the left foreground from a rocky outcropping. A man is visible standing on the point of a towering rocky canyon wall in the distance. The eroded canyon wall opposite stretches far into the distance where the rim forms a flat horizon.
